Page 276 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 通常モードに戻る ┃ INDEX ┃ ≪前へ │ 次へ≫ 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 ▼ここに来るマクロは? ぴかる 02/10/30(水) 18:03 ┗Re:ここに来るマクロは? コロスケ 02/10/30(水) 18:14 ┗Re:ここに来るマクロは? ぴかる 02/10/30(水) 18:55 ┗ハイパーリンクで出来ました。 ぴかる 02/10/30(水) 20:17 ─────────────────────────────────────── ■題名 : ここに来るマクロは? ■名前 : ぴかる ■日付 : 02/10/30(水) 18:03 -------------------------------------------------------------------------
こんにちは。 ここに来るマクロボタンを作りたいんですが、どうやったら良いのでしょうか? ↓を動作させたいと思ってます。 http://www.vbalab.net/vbaqa/c-board.cgi?id=excel よろしくお願いいたします。 |
▼ぴかる さん: こんにちは。いろんな方法がありますが、一例です。 シート上にコマンドボタンがあると想定しています。 Option Explicit 'Microsoft Internet Controlsを参照設定 Private WithEvents ie As SHDocVw.internetexplorer Private Sub CommandButton1_Click() Const url As String = _ "http://www.vbalab.net/vbaqa/c-board.cgi?cmd=one;no=1408;id=excel" If ie Is Nothing Then Set ie = New SHDocVw.internetexplorer ie.navigate url ie.Visible = True Set ie = Nothing End Sub |
コロスケさん、こんにちは。 コロスケさんからのご回答お待ちしておりました。ありがとうございます。 正直単純なマクロかな?と思ってたんですが、そうは行かないみたいですね。 >Option Explicit >'Microsoft Internet Controlsを参照設定 >Private WithEvents ie As SHDocVw.internetexplorer ↑で少し不具合が出ました。私の環境の問題かな? シートモジュールでは、コンパイルエラー。標準モジュールでは、赤字表示となります。 すみませんが再度教えて頂けないでしょうか?。出来れば標準モジュールにて行いたいと考えております。 すごくワガママなんですが、"ピカつーる"に使わせて頂きたいと思っております。 問題がないようでしたら、ご協力よろしくお願いいたします。 |
ぴかるさん、こんばんは。 初めてハイパーリンクを設定して自力でもやってみました。そしてそれをマクロ記録してみたらうまく出来るようになりました。ありがとうございました。 |